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- CMD:car(playerid,params[])
- {
- if(DostupForAdministration{playerid} == false || PlayerInfo[playerid][pAdmin] < 3) return true;
- if(GetPlayerInterior(playerid) != 0) return SCM(playerid,COLOR_RED,"Нельзя создать транспорт в интерьере");
- if(IsPlayerInAnyVehicle(playerid)) return SCM(playerid,COLOR_RED,"Выйдите из транспорта");
- if(sscanf(params,"d",params[0])) return SCM(playerid,COLOR_WHITE,"Введите: /car [id машины]");
- if(params[0] > 611 || params[0] < 400) return SCM(playerid,COLOR_RED, "ID транспорта от 400 до 611");
- if(params[0] == 435 || params[0] == 441 || params[0] == 449 || params[0] == 450 || params[0] == 464 || params[0] == 465 || params[0] == 537 || params[0] == 538 || params[0] == 569 || params[0] == 570 || params[0] == 584 || params[0] == 590 || params[0] == 591 || params[0] == 594 || params[0] == 606 || params[0] == 607 || params[0] == 608 || params[0] == 610 || params[0] == 611) return SCM(playerid,COLOR_RED,"Указан невалидный ID транспорта");
- new virt = GetPlayerVirtualWorld(playerid);
- new Float:X,Float:Y,Float:Z,Float:angle;
- GetPlayerPos(playerid,X,Y,Z);
- GetPlayerFacingAngle(playerid,angle);
- new carid = CreateVehicle(params[0],X,Y,Z+1,angle,1,1,60000,1);
- new engine,lights,alarm,doors,bonnet,boot,objective;
- GetVehicleParamsEx(carid,engine,lights,alarm,doors,bonnet,boot,objective);
- SetVehicleParamsEx(carid,true,true,alarm,doors,bonnet,boot,objective);
- Vehicle[carid][ServerVehicle] = false;
- Vehicle[carid][CarLock] = false;
- Vehicle[carid][TimeFuel] = 0;
- Vehicle[carid][Fuel] = 200;
- Vehicle[carid][Engine] = true;
- Vehicle[carid][Acar] = true;
- PutPlayerInVehicles(playerid,carid,0);
- SetVehicleVirtualWorld(carid,virt);
- format(nsa,128,"Транспорт ID %d создан",params[0]);
- SCM(playerid,COLOR_RED,nsa);
- return true;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ement